Abstract
Aim: to compare cyclic fatigue resistance of new and sterilized HyFlex CM® files at apical and coronal levels. Methods: 180 files were divided in six groups (n=30): two of new files (A5, A11), two autoclaved once (B5, B11) and two autoclaved twice (C5, C11). Cyclic fatigue resistance was tested at 5 mm and at 11 mm from the tip. Weibull analysis was used to calculate the mean life, beta, and eta parameters. Results: New files will last significantly longer than files that were sterilized once or twice, with a probability of 72% and 61% at 5 mm from the tip and 75% and 72% at 11 mm from the tip, respectively. There was no statistically significant difference between the mean life of the files sterilized once or twice at 11 mm from the tip, but at 5 mm from the tip, files sterilized twice was significantly longer than those sterilized once, with a probability of 63%. Files will last significantly longer at 5 mm than 11 mm from the tip with a probability higher than 99%. Conclusions: HyFlex CM® files were more resistant to cyclic fatigue at the apical than the coronal levels. Unsterilized HyFlex CM® files were the most resistant.
